A Step Forward Each Day: Recovery's Journey

Recovery is rarely a simple path. It's often a winding road filled with surprising twists and turns. Instead of focusing on the complete journey, try to embrace the power of one day at a time. Every step forward, no matter how minor, is a success. Celebrate those progresses and learn from the obstacles that may arise. Remember, recovery is a continuous journey. Be patient with yourself, practice self-care, and seek help when needed.

  • Focus on the present moment: Let go of past regrets and anxieties about the future.
  • Set realistic goals: Don't try to change everything at once. Start with small, achievable steps.
  • Practice self-compassion: Be kind to yourself, especially during difficult times.
